Located in Suffolk County, Massachusetts, Forest Hills is a charming neighborhood that offers a perfect blend of suburban tranquility and urban convenience. With its rich history and close proximity to Boston, this hidden gem is a favored destination for residents and visitors alike.
Forest Hills is situated in the southwestern part of the city of Boston, making it an ideal residential area for those who appreciate a peaceful environment away from the hustle and bustle of downtown. The neighborhood is known for its tree-lined streets, picturesque parks, and close-knit community feel.
One of the highlights of Forest Hills is the Arnold Arboretum, a world-renowned botanical garden and research facility operated by Harvard University. Spanning over 265 acres, the arboretum offers stunning landscapes, countless varieties of trees and plants, and extensive walking trails where visitors can immerse themselves in the beauty of nature. It is a popular spot for picnics, leisurely walks, and outdoor activities all year round.
For those seeking a taste of history, Forest Hills is home to the Forest Hills Cemetery, one of America’s most significant Victorian cemeteries. Established in 1848, this cemetery is not only a final resting place for many notable figures, including poet e.e. cummings and former President John F. Kennedy’s family members, but it also serves as an outdoor gallery of stunning sculptures and architectural landmarks.
Residents of Forest Hills enjoy easy access to a wide range of amenities and services. The neighborhood is well-served by public transportation, with Forest Hills Station serving as a major transportation hub. From here, commuters can quickly reach downtown Boston and other parts of the city via the Orange Line subway and several bus routes.
